Newlite Nightwatcher outdoor security light with robotic light head

Monday, 08 November, 2010 | Supplied by: Newlite Pty Ltd


The Nightwatcher outdoor motion-activated security light features a robotic light head which eliminates security blind spots by tracking motion within its 220° active detection zone.

In the event of motion being detected, the light head will automatically activate and then robotically turn towards the breached zone to illuminate the area. At the same time, it transmits a 30 m signal to the optional ‘alarm plus’ monitor to audibly indicate the breach. The light head will stay illuminated for three minutes on the last breached zone and then return to its standby mode ready to resume operation.

The light features a microprocessor-controlled stepper motor to automatically turn the light head 140° and three passive infrared detection zones that have a total coverage of 220° and a range of up to 10 m.

It is available with either a 150 W halogen lamp or an energy-efficient 8 W ‘super-bright’ LED light head which has an extended lamp life of up to 50,000 h. The main body and light head is constructed from PVC and aluminium and has an IP55 rating to tolerate adverse weather conditions.

It is easy to install on a flat wall and is suitable for deterring intruders. Each model is available in black, white and silver.
